Blackbox DM 500-C cable receiver: overview

The Blackbox DM 500-C cable receiver is designed to deliver an advanced experience in digital TV and satellite radio reception. Equipped with a powerful 300 MIPS processor and Linux operating system, this receiver supports the Linux TV API and lets you enjoy high-definition content with multiple connectivity options.

Main features

  • Processor: 300 MIPS for optimal performance.
  • Operating system: Linux, compatible with the TV API.
  • Display: Bright OLED screen for clear information.
  • Decoding: Hardware for MPEG-2 and H.264.
  • Tuners: DVB-S with options for DVB-C and DVB-T.
  • Connectivity: Ethernet 10/100Mbit, USB 2.0 (x2), DVI, Scart (RGB, FBAS, S-Video), RS232, optical S/PDIF.
  • Storage: Support for internal 2.5" SATA hard drive or external eSATA.
  • Additional functions: Unlimited channel lists, automatic scan, electronic programme guide (EPG), DiSEqC control for LNB and rotor.

Technical specifications

  • Tuner frequency: 950 to 2150 MHz.
  • Modulation: DVB-S (QPSK), DVB-S2 (8PSK, QPSK).
  • Symbol rate: DVB-S: 2-45 Mbaud/s; DVB-S2: 10-31 Mbaud/s (8PSK), 10-30 Mbaud/s (QPSK).
  • Video: Compatible with MPEG-1, MPEG-2, H.264; 4:3 and 16:9 formats.
  • Audio: MPEG-1 and MPEG-2, MP3, stereo and dual mode.
  • Analogue output: L/R level 0.5 Vss, THD > 60 dB.
  • Digital output: Toslink optical S/PDIF.
  • Interfaces: Bidirectional RS232, Ethernet 10/100Mbit, USB 2.0 (x2), SATA for 2.5" HDD.
  • Power supply: External 12V, 3A.
  • Power consumption: Less than 15W.
  • Dimensions: 195 x 140 x 40 mm.
  • Weight: 1.8 kg without hard drive.

Typical uses

This receiver is ideal for users who want to receive satellite TV signals with high quality and flexibility. It can be used at home to enjoy digital channels and radio stations, as well as in professional environments that require a reliable receiver with multiple input and output options. Its compatibility with SATA hard drives allows you to record programmes and manage multimedia content.

Compatibility

Compatible with DVB-S, DVB-C and DVB-T systems, this receiver integrates easily with satellite dishes and signal distribution systems. In addition, its support for the Linux TV API and multiple interfaces makes integration with other devices and software updates easier.

Customer Questions & Answers

What signal types and video formats does the Blackbox DM 500-C receiver support?

The Blackbox DM 500-C receiver supports DVB-C signals (digital cable), as well as MPEG-1, MPEG-2 and H.264 video formats, and allows 4:3 and 16:9 output formats. This makes it compatible with both standard and widescreen TVs. The format selection depends on the content and the TV being used.

Is any specific software or operating system required to get the unit up and running and manage it?

The receiver uses a Linux-based operating system with support for the Linux TV API, which allows advanced device management. No additional software is needed for basic functions, although it can be customised with alternative community firmware to add features, at the user’s discretion.

What limitations does the unit have in terms of memory capacity and internal storage?

The Blackbox DM 500-C has 64 MB of flash memory and 256 MB of RAM, which are suitable for most standard functions. For recording storage, it supports internal or external 2.5" SATA hard drives via eSATA. It does not support IDE drives or USB storage as the main recording destination. The disk capacity limit will depend on the firmware’s partitioning support.

Is there a warranty, spare parts support, or easily replaceable components, especially the tuner?

The DM800 series tuner is modular and Plug&Play, which makes replacement easy in the event of a fault or a change of standard. Warranty coverage usually depends on the distributor and may vary from 1 to 2 years. It is advisable to check the availability of spare modules and technical support before purchase.
